What they do

A Nursing Assistant provides hospital and nursing home patients with basic care and assists them with daily activities. Helps patients with dressing, washing, and feeding. May perform basic medical care under the direction of a nurse or other medical professional. These roles typically require completion of a regional agency-approved training program in order to obtain a certification before practicing.

Responsibilities:
Provide our clients with safe, compassionate, and reliable care with dignity. Assist with personal care tasks such as bathing, grooming, dressing, and toileting. Assist with mobility and transfers, including using mobility aids and equipment. Medication reminder.
Basic food preparation:
assist with meal preparation and feeding, ensuring dietary requirements are met and shopping. Perform light housekeeping duties, including cleaning and organizing the client's living space. Provide companionship and emotional support to clients. Veteran care, Alzheimer's care, and Dementia care. Back-up care (or respite) services: providing other caregivers a break.
Requirements:
Previous experience and must have certification. Knowledge of basic medical terminology and procedures. Ability to follow medical documentation procedures accurately. Ability to work independently and demonstrate initiative. Must have a valid driver's license, auto insurance, and reliable transportation. Must pass a background check and drug screening
